基于稳态视觉诱发电位的脑 机接口实验研究

摘    要:为提取应用于脑-机接口系统的稳态视觉诱发电位信号(SSVEP),运用叠加平均与快速傅里叶变换(FFT)相结合的方法,由其频谱图上得到作为输入信号的稳态视觉诱发电位信号.通过实验确定了叠加平均次数与最佳视觉刺激颜色,并对混合闪光刺激下SSVEP的提取进行了研究.实验结果表明,该方法提取出的SSVEP信号能够反映使用者的控制意图,可应用于脑-机接口系统.

An Experimental Research on Brain-Computer Interface Based on Steady State Visual Evoked Potential

Abstract:For acquiring steady state visual evoked potential(SSVEP)applied to brain-computer interface system,a method combining average and FFT is proposed.Input signal are obtained by their frequency figure of SSVEP.Times of average and best color of visual stimulation are confirmed by experiments.A method of acquiring SSVEP with mixed visual stimulation is studied.Experiments showed that SSVEP can reflect the control purposes of users and can be applied to BCI system.
